Conversions de documents maîtres dans .NET à l’aide de GroupDocs.Conversion

Introduction

Vous rencontrez des difficultés avec la conversion de documents dans vos applications .NET ? Vous n’êtes pas seul. De nombreux développeurs doivent déterminer efficacement les formats vers lesquels un document peut être converti. GroupDocs.Conversion pour .NET offre une intégration transparente et des fonctionnalités robustes, ce qui en fait un outil essentiel pour améliorer les capacités des applications. Dans ce guide complet, nous explorerons comment exploiter GroupDocs.Conversion pour .NET afin de déterminer les conversions possibles pour tout document source. Que vous travailliez sur un projet nécessitant la conversion de documents entre différents formats ou que vous cherchiez simplement à améliorer les fonctionnalités de votre application, ce guide est conçu pour vous aider.

Ce que vous apprendrez :

  • L’importance de déterminer les conversions possibles de documents.
  • Comment configurer et utiliser GroupDocs.Conversion pour .NET dans vos projets.
  • Mise en œuvre étape par étape de la fonctionnalité « Obtenir les conversions possibles ».
  • Applications pratiques et conseils d’optimisation des performances. Plongeons dans les prérequis avant de commencer à configurer GroupDocs.Conversion pour .NET !

Prérequis

Avant de pouvoir commencer à utiliser GroupDocs.Conversion pour .NET, assurez-vous de disposer des éléments suivants :

Bibliothèques et dépendances requises

  • GroupDocs.Conversion pour .NET bibliothèque. Assurez-vous de travailler avec la version 25.3.0 ou ultérieure.

Configuration requise pour l’environnement

  • Un environnement de développement prenant en charge .NET (par exemple, Visual Studio).
  • Connaissances de base de la programmation C#.

Prérequis en matière de connaissances

  • La connaissance des concepts de conversion de documents et de l’écosystème .NET est bénéfique mais pas obligatoire.

Configuration de GroupDocs.Conversion pour .NET

Pour commencer, vous devez installer GroupDocs.Conversion pour .NET dans votre projet. Vous pouvez le faire via le gestionnaire de packages NuGet ou l’interface de ligne de commande .NET. Console du gestionnaire de packages NuGet :

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I :

dotnet add package GroupDocs.Conversion --version 25.3.0

Étapes d’acquisition de licence

  1. Essai gratuit: Commencez par télécharger un essai gratuit pour explorer toutes les fonctionnalités de GroupDocs.Conversion.
  2. Licence temporaire:Si vous avez besoin d’un accès étendu sans limitations, envisagez d’obtenir une licence temporaire.
  3. Achat: Pour une utilisation à long terme, achetez une licence via Site officiel de GroupDocs.

Initialisation et configuration de base

Une fois installé, l’initialisation de GroupDocs.Conversion est simple :

using GroupDocs.Conversion;
// Initialisez la classe Converter avec le chemin de votre document.
Converter converter = new Converter(@"YOUR_DOCUMENT_DIRECTORY\sample.docx");

Guide de mise en œuvre : déterminer les formats de documents possibles

Maintenant que tout est configuré, implémentons la fonctionnalité pour déterminer les conversions possibles.

Aperçu des fonctionnalités

La fonctionnalité « Obtenir les conversions possibles » vous permet d’identifier tous les formats vers lesquels un document peut être converti. Cette fonctionnalité est essentielle pour les applications nécessitant des solutions de gestion documentaire flexibles.

Étape 1 : Définir le chemin du document

Commencez par spécifier le chemin d’accès à votre document :

string documentPath = @"YOUR_DOCUMENT_DIRECTORY\sample.docx";

Étape 2 : Initialiser la classe de convertisseur

Initialiser une nouvelle instance du Converter classe avec le chemin défini :

using (Converter converter = new Converter(documentPath))
{
    // Un traitement ultérieur sera effectué ici.
}

Étape 3 : Récupérer les conversions possibles

Utilisez le GetPossibleConversions méthode pour récupérer les possibilités de conversion pour votre document :

PossibleConversions conversions = converter.GetPossibleConversions();

Étape 4 : Itérer et afficher les détails de la conversion

Parcourez chaque possibilité de conversion pour déterminer s’il s’agit d’une option principale ou secondaire. Affichez ensuite les résultats :

foreach (var conversion in conversions.All)
{
    string conversionType = conversion.IsPrimary ? "primary" : "secondary";
    Console.WriteLine($"\t {conversion.Format} as {conversionType} conversion.");
}

Options de configuration clés

  • Conversion spécifique au format: Personnalisez les paramètres de conversion pour des formats spécifiques.
  • Gestion des erreurs: Implémentez des blocs try-catch pour gérer les exceptions avec élégance.

Conseils de dépannage

  • Assurez-vous que le chemin du document est correct et accessible.
  • Vérifiez si toutes les bibliothèques nécessaires sont correctement installées.
  • Vérifiez la compatibilité de la version de GroupDocs.Conversion avec votre environnement .NET.

Applications pratiques

  1. Systèmes de gestion de documents:Déterminez automatiquement les formats de conversion pour les documents téléchargés par l’utilisateur.
  2. Outils de migration de contenu: Identifier les formats compatibles lors des processus de migration de données.
  3. Services API:Offrez des services de conversion de documents dynamiques aux clients en fonction des formats pris en charge.

Possibilités d’intégration

GroupDocs.Conversion peut être intégré à d’autres systèmes .NET tels que les applications ASP.NET, les applications de bureau utilisant WPF ou WinForms, etc.

Considérations relatives aux performances

  • Optimisez les performances en limitant le nombre de conversions simultanées.
  • Gérez efficacement l’utilisation des ressources grâce à des techniques de gestion de la mémoire appropriées dans .NET.
  • Utilisez la programmation asynchrone pour gérer les tâches de conversion sans bloquer les threads.

Conclusion

En suivant ce guide, vous avez appris à configurer GroupDocs.Conversion pour .NET et à implémenter une fonctionnalité permettant de déterminer les formats de documents possibles. Cette fonctionnalité est précieuse pour les applications nécessitant des options de conversion de documents polyvalentes.

Prochaines étapes

Explorez d’autres fonctionnalités de GroupDocs.Conversion telles que les conversions spécifiques au format ou le traitement par lots pour améliorer les fonctionnalités de votre application. Prêt à aller plus loin ? Essayez dès aujourd’hui d’implémenter cette solution dans vos projets !

Section FAQ

  1. Quels types de fichiers GroupDocs.Conversion prend-il en charge pour .NET ?
    • Il prend en charge une large gamme de formats de documents, notamment Word, Excel, PDF et bien d’autres.
  2. Puis-je convertir entre deux formats à l’aide de GroupDocs.Conversion ?
    • Bien qu’il prenne en charge de nombreux formats, vérifiez les capacités de conversion spécifiques à votre type de document.
  3. Y a-t-il une limite au nombre de documents que je peux traiter simultanément ?
    • Les performances peuvent varier en fonction des ressources système ; envisagez le traitement par lots si nécessaire.
  4. Comment gérer les exceptions lors des conversions ?
    • Implémentez des blocs try-catch autour du code de conversion pour gérer les erreurs potentielles avec élégance.
  5. GroupDocs.Conversion peut-il être utilisé pour des applications à grande échelle ?
    • Oui, avec une gestion des ressources et des stratégies d’optimisation appropriées.

Ressources